Payment Methods That Work Down Under

Depositing and withdrawing money on a mobile casino needs to be quick and simple. Australian players have their favourites: POLi, PayID, and bank transfers lead the pack. POLi lets you pay directly from your bank account without a credit card, while PayID offers instant deposits using just your mobile number or email. These methods are built for the way Aussies bank.

Feature POLi PayID Credit Card
Speed Instant deposit Instant deposit Instant deposit
Fees Usually free Free May incur cash advance fee
Withdrawal Not available for withdrawals Available (fast) Often not accepted for withdrawals
Aussie-specific Yes, very common Yes, widely used Less popular locally

A reliable mobile casino will offer at least two of these options and process withdrawals within 24 hours. The days of waiting a week for your winnings are fading. Many sites now pay out via PayID in under an hour, which is a game-changer for players who want their money fast.

Security and Licensing – Playing Safe

Mobile casinos must meet the same standards as their desktop counterparts. Australian players should only sign up with sites licensed by reputable authorities – the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ming license are common. However, note that the Australian Interactive Gambling Act restricts offshore operators from offering real-money games to Aussies, so many players use sites based overseas.

That doesn’t mean you should ignore security. Look for SSL encryption (the padlock icon in your browser), responsible gambling tools like deposit limits and self-exclusion, and clear privacy policies. A trustworthy mobile casino will also display its licensing information prominently. If a site looks dodgy or asks for excessive personal data, steer clear. Your phone holds a lot of sensitive info – keep it safe.
